Billingshurst Train Station is well-equipped to accommodate the needs of its passengers. The ticket office is open from early morning to late evening during weekdays, with reduced hours over the weekend, allowing you to plan your journey flexibly. For those who prefer the convenience of technology, ticket machines are available for both ticket purchases and collection. Plus, these machines support discounts for Disabled Persons Railcard holders, ensuring that everyone can easily access rail travel. With smartcard validators, you can enjoy the ease of contactless travel.
For your comfort and security, the station provides CCTV coverage, and customer help points are strategically placed on the platforms for any assistance you may require. Although the station lacks waiting rooms and accessible toilets, there's still seating available for passengers and a staff-operated ramp ensures that boarding is feasible for all, despite step-free access being limited in certain areas.
Although Billingshurst has limited step-free access between platforms, assistance is just a call away. Staff are on hand during key hours, and a dedicated number for assisted travel is available for arranging any special requirements you might have. It’s always a wise idea to notify the station in advance to ensure a smoother journey. Just remember, there's no waiting room office, so plan your arrival time accordingly, especially during rainy days.

Turkey Street station is equipped with a variety of facilities to make your journey convenient. The ticket office is open from 06:30 to 10:00 on weekdays and from 09:45 to 13:00 on Saturdays, ensuring you have access to purchase tickets. Plus, ticket machines are available for a quick and easy self-service option. Online ticket purchases are easily collected at these machines as well, making your entry into the station seamless. The station also includes an induction loop to assist those who are hearing impaired.
While Turkey Street offers accessible ticket machines and seating areas, the station lacks step-free access and other amenities like ramps for train access. However, there are help points available if you need assistance. CCTV cameras provide additional security, so you can feel safe while you travel.
Turkey Street station offers seamless onward connections to keep your journey going smoothly. Transport for London buses operate right from outside the station, providing you a convenient transition from train to bus. For rail replacement services, use bus stop G for northbound services to Cheshunt and bus stop L for southbound services to Liverpool Street, ensuring you’re never stuck on your journey.
